Combines the theory and the practice of applied digital control
This book presents the theory and application of microcontroller
based automatic control systems. Microcontrollers are single-chip
computers which can be used to control real-time systems. Low-cost,
single chip and easy to program, they have traditionally been
programmed using the assembly language of the target processor.
Recent developments in this field mean that it is now possible to
program these devices using high-level languages such as BASIC,
PASCAL, or C. As a result, very complex control algorithms can be
developed and implemented on the microcontrollers.

Describing the use of displays in microcontroller based
projects, the author makes extensive use of real-world, tested
projects. The complete details of each project are given, including
the full circuit diagram and source code. The author explains how
to program microcontrollers (in C language) with LED, LCD and GLCD
displays; and gives a brief theory about the operation, advantages
and disadvantages of each type of display.
